About the Role
We are seeking a talented and motivated Recently Qualified Architect (Part III) to join our growing team. This is an exciting opportunity for a driven individual at the early stages of their career to contribute to a diverse range of projects while developing their professional skills in a supportive and collaborative environ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ist in the design and delivery of architectural projects across all RIBA work stages
- Produce high-quality drawings, models, and presentations
- Support project coordination with consultants, contractors, and clients
- Prepare planning applications and building regulations submissions
- Attend site visits and assist with contract administration duties
- Ensure compliance with UK building regulations and industry standards
- Contribute to design discussions and studio culture
Requirements
- ARB registered Architect (or eligible for registration)
- RIBA Part III qualification (recently completed)
- Strong design, technical, and presentation skills
- Proficiency in relevant software (e.g., AutoCAD, Revit, Adobe Creative Suite; knowledge of BIM is desirable)
- Good understanding of UK planning system and building regulations
- Excellent communication and organisational skills
- Ability to work both independently and as part of a team
